Boattest.com Review

Overview

The Chaparral 224 Sinesta is an entry-level sport deck boat that skillfully blends the agile handling characteristics of a sport boat with the spaciousness typical of a deck boat. Designed to offer versatility and comfort, this model caters to boaters seeking both performance and ample room for socializing and relaxation.

Helm and Cockpit Features

The helm of the 224 Sinesta is thoughtfully designed with a dark panel to minimize glare, enhancing visibility during operation. Analog gauges flank a central pull-out storage compartment, which can be replaced with an optional Garmin GPS unit. A distinctive paneled dimmer knob controls instrument lighting, and a compass is positioned directly in line with the helm seat for easy navigation. The test boat featured an upgraded leather steering wheel with a logo that remains upright regardless of wheel position. Beneath the console, a courtesy light provides illumination. On the port side, a console door with dual latches opens to a changing room that can be optionally equipped with a head, port light, and sink. Both captain and observer seats are comfortable bucket-style, featuring wrap-around support, sliding and swiveling capabilities, and flip-up bolsters for added versatility.

Cockpit Layout and Amenities

The cockpit includes L-shaped seating with storage compartments beneath, except for the aft seat, which sits atop the engine box. Dedicated storage is provided for a removable 25-quart cooler, and a side-mount pedestal base accommodates an optional cockpit table. The cockpit drains lead directly into the bilge for efficient water management. A notable feature is the aft seat’s ability to fold forward, transforming into a sun pad with a lounge position for enhanced comfort. On the starboard side, a standard wet bar includes a recessed sink with a pull-out sprayer set into a solid surface countertop, complemented by a conveniently located trash receptacle. Additional storage houses the battery switch and an optional inflator for water toys. The walk-through to the windshield measures 19 inches wide, and an access door to the helm console doubles as an air dam.

Bow Area and Additional Features

The bow area benefits from a wide tech design, creating a spacious environment with contoured seating and storage beneath. An insulated cooler is integrated under the forward cushion, featuring a drainage system. The optional cockpit table can also be installed here with a side-mount base. An optional filler cushion converts the entire bow seating area into a large sun pad. At the very front, there is an optional second shower concealed near a four-step reboarding ladder, enhancing convenience for swimmers and water sports enthusiasts.

Power and Performance

Powered by a Mercruiser 260 horsepower catalyzed 5.0-liter MPI engine paired with an Alpha One drive and a 17-inch Mercury inertia propeller, the 224 Sinesta demonstrated strong performance during testing. The boat achieved a top speed of 46.9 miles per hour at 5120 RPM, consuming fuel at a rate of 23.2 gallons per hour, which provided a range of approximately 89 miles. The most efficient cruising speed was found at 3000 RPM, delivering 23.4 miles per hour while reducing fuel consumption to 6.1 gallons per hour. At this setting, the boat could operate for over seven hours and cover 169 miles while maintaining a 10% fuel reserve. The hull’s extended V-plane running surface contributed to a quick planing time of 3.8 seconds, with acceleration to 20 miles per hour in 6.6 seconds and 30 miles per hour in 9.5 seconds. During acceleration, the bow rises 16 degrees without obstructing forward visibility. The boat handles turns with a slight slide and rolls 16 degrees into turns, providing a comfortable and controlled ride. When decelerating, the stern settles first, again raising the bow and preserving visibility.

Engine Compartment and Storage

The engine compartment is accessed via a hatch supported by two struts, allowing easy lifting. The space is ample enough to reach both sides of the engine for maintenance, with the forward end of the compartment positioned low for improved accessibility. Between the forward seats, there is a large sole storage compartment measuring 1 foot 8 inches deep and 6 feet long, featuring a hatch held open by a strut and a drain leading into the bilge.

Stern Features and Additional Equipment

At the stern, the boat is equipped with a full-beam molded swim platform extending two feet from the transom. A stereo remote control is conveniently located on the port side near the outdrive trim switch. The water fill is positioned adjacent to an optional shower, and fuel fills are accessible on both port and starboard sides. A double-wide aft-facing rumble seat, measuring 2 feet 11 inches wide, offers a comfortable spot to relax when the boat is stationary. The standard bimini top includes forward eyes and glass windows without requiring a full wraparound canvas package. The windows measure approximately 1 foot 10 inches across in the center and 1 foot 11 inches on the sides, supported by a solid bar for the forward frame instead of the typical strap, enhancing durability and aesthetics.

Conclusion

The Chaparral 224 Sinesta presents a compelling combination of sporty handling and spacious deck boat accommodations. Its well-thought-out helm and cockpit features, efficient powertrain, and versatile seating arrangements make it suitable for a variety of recreational boating activities. The boat’s performance metrics demonstrate strong acceleration, comfortable handling, and efficient cruising capabilities, while its ample storage and optional amenities provide added convenience and comfort for day outings on the water.

The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 2014 Chaparral 224 Sunesta offers a blend of style, comfort, and performance, making it a popular choice for recreational boating. Here are some pros and cons to consider:

Pros

Spacious Layout: The 224 Sunesta features a roomy cockpit with ample seating, ideal for socializing and entertaining.

Quality Construction: Chaparral is known for solid build quality, and this model showcases durable materials and attention to detail.

Versatile Performance: Powered by reliable engines, it delivers smooth handling and good speed for watersports or cruising.

Comfort Features: Includes convenient amenities such as a swim platform, sunpad, and optional Bimini top for shade.

Storage Capacity: Offers generous storage compartments for gear, safety equipment, and personal items.

Cons

Limited Cabin Space: While it has a small cuddy cabin, it may be cramped for overnight stays or extended trips.

Fuel Efficiency: Depending on engine choice and usage, fuel consumption can be on the higher side.

Price Point: As a well-equipped model, it may be priced higher than some competitors in the same class.

Maintenance: Like many fiberglass boats, it requires regular upkeep to maintain its finish and mechanical systems.
